Генетические алгоритмы в космической навигации: новые технологии повышения точности межзвёздных полётов

Современная космическая навигация занимает ключевую роль в развитии межзвёздных полётов и освоении дальних уголков Вселенной. Точность управления траекторией космических аппаратов напрямую влияет на успешность миссий и безопасность аппаратов. В данной области значительные перспективы открывают методы искусственного интеллекта, среди которых особое место занимают генетические алгоритмы. Их уникальная способность к оптимизации сложных систем и адаптации к динамически меняющимся условиям позволяет существенно повысить точность и эффективность навигационных вычислений.

Генетические алгоритмы (ГА) — это методы оптимизации, вдохновлённые биологическими процессами естественного отбора и эволюции. Их применение в задачах космической навигации связано с поиском оптимальных траекторий, распределения ресурсов и управлению полётными параметрами при огромном количестве переменных и ограничений. В статье подробно рассмотрены принципы работы генетических алгоритмов, области их использования в межзвёздных полётах, а также обзор современных технологий, которые позволяют повысить точность и безопасность космических миссий.

Основы генетических алгоритмов и их преимущества в навигационных системах

Генетические алгоритмы — это стохастические методы оптимизации, основанные на моделировании естественного отбора в природе. Основные элементы ГА включают популяцию кандидатов решений, операторы скрещивания, мутации и селекции, направленные на поиск решений с максимальной приспособленностью. Такие алгоритмы особенно эффективны в случаях, когда пространство поиска является многомерным, нелинейным и содержит множество локальных минимумов и максимумов.

В навигационных системах космических аппаратов ГА позволяют решать сложные задачи, такие как оптимизация траекторий движения, минимизация расхода топлива и времени полёта, а также адаптация к непредвиденным изменениям среды. Основные преимущества этих методов включают:

  • Умение работать с большими и сложными пространствами поиска.
  • Гибкость и адаптивность к изменениям начальных условий и параметров задачи.
  • Параллельность вычислений, что ускоряет процесс оптимизации.

Принцип работы генетических алгоритмов

Работа ГА начинается с создания начальной популяции случайных решений. Каждое решение оценивается по функции приспособленности, отражающей качество навигационного параметра. Затем путем операторов селекции выбираются решения для создания нового поколения посредством скрещивания и мутаций. Процесс повторяется до достижения оптимального или близкого к нему решения.

Важной особенностью ГА является баланс между исследованием пространства поиска и эксплуатацией уже найденных хороших решений, что позволяет избегать застревания в локальных оптимумах и достигать более качественных результатов.

Применение генетических алгоритмов в межзвёздной навигации

Межзвёздные полёты требуют высокой точности расчетов и способности навигационной системы адаптироваться к непредсказуемым факторам, таким как гравитационные возмущения, космическое излучение и прочие нелинейные эффекты. Генетические алгоритмы успешно применяются в ряде ключевых направлений:

  • Оптимизация траекторий космических аппаратов: ГА позволяют находить траектории с минимальным затратами энергии и временем полёта, учитывая множество ограничений.
  • Калибровка навигационных систем: С помощью ГА происходит точная настройка параметров сенсоров и управления, что повышает общую надёжность систем навигации.
  • Обработка данных с датчиков: Алгоритмы помогают фильтровать и интерпретировать шумы и ошибки, что повышает качество определения положения и ориентации аппарата.

Пример задачи оптимизации траектории

Одной из наиболее сложных задач является построение оптимальной траектории с учётом гравитационных полей различных планет и звёзд. Генетические алгоритмы здесь позволяют выполнять следующие шаги:

  1. Задание начальной популяции траекторий с различными параметрами.
  2. Оценка каждой траектории по критериям времени, расхода топлива и безопасности.
  3. Отбор лучших траекторий и их рекомбинация с некоторой вероятностью мутации.
  4. Постепенное совершенствование путей до достижения приемлемой точности.

Современные технологии и интеграция генетических алгоритмов в навигационные системы

С развитием вычислительной техники и искусственного интеллекта, генетические алгоритмы интегрируются с другими методами оптимизации и машинного обучения. Такой гибридный подход позволяет добиться высокой производительности и устойчивости навигационных систем при межзвёздных полётах.

Например, комбинирование ГА с нейросетями используется для автоматической настройки параметров алгоритма и предсказания поведения космического аппарата в реальном времени. Кроме того, алгоритмы реализуются на специализированных аппаратных платформах, ускоряя вычисления и снижая энергопотребление.

Сравнение традиционных методов навигации и генетических алгоритмов

Критерий Традиционные методы Генетические алгоритмы
Обработка сложных многомерных задач Ограничена, часто требует упрощений Высокая адаптивность и эффективность
Нахождение глобальных оптимумов Часто застревают в локальных решениях Способны избегать локальных минимумов
Скорость вычислений Быстрая при простых задачах, медленная на сложных Высокая при использовании параллелизма
Гибкость и адаптация Низкая, трудно менять параметры в полёте Высокая, параметры можно адаптировать динамически

Технические инновации в области реализации алгоритмов

Новейшие разработки включают использование квантовых вычислений в сочетании с генетическими алгоритмами, что позволяет существенно увеличить масштабируемость и скорость оптимизации. Кроме того, внедряются облачные вычислительные платформы для моделирования и тестирования различных сценариев межзвёздных полётов, используя ГА для оценки большого количества вариантов навигационных решений.

Другим важным направлением является создание автономных навигационных систем на базе ГА, способных самостоятельно адаптироваться к изменяющимся условиям без необходимости постоянного вмешательства с Земли, что критично при работе на огромных дистанциях.

Заключение

Генетические алгоритмы представляют собой перспективный и эффективный инструмент для решения сложных задач космической навигации, особенно в условиях межзвёздных полётов. Их способность работать с многомерными и динамичными системами, находить глобальные оптимумы и адаптироваться к изменениям позволяют значительно повысить точность управления космическими аппаратами и безопасность миссий.

Современные технологии интеграции ГА в навигационные системы, включая гибридные методы и специализированные вычислительные платформы, открывают новые возможности для развития автономных и устойчивых систем управления межзвёздными полётами. В ближайшем будущем генетические алгоритмы, вероятно, станут неотъемлемой частью программ освоения космоса, способствуя достижению новых рубежей в исследовании Вселенной.

Что такое генетические алгоритмы и как они применяются в космической навигации?

Генетические алгоритмы – это метод оптимизации, основанный на принципах естественного отбора и эволюции. В космической навигации они применяются для поиска оптимальных траекторий и параметров движения космических аппаратов, позволяя повысить точность и эффективность межзвёздных полётов даже в условиях высокой неопределённости и сложных пространственных задач.

Какие преимущества генетических алгоритмов по сравнению с традиционными методами навигации в космосе?

Генетические алгоритмы обладают высокой способностью находить глобальные оптимумы в сложных многомерных пространствах, устойчивы к локальным минимумам и эффективно работают с шумными и неполными данными. Это делает их особенно полезными для межзвёздной навигации, где традиционные методы могут сталкиваться с ограничениями в точности и адаптивности.

Какие новые технологии интегрируются с генетическими алгоритмами для улучшения межзвёздных полётов?

Современные разработки включают интеграцию генетических алгоритмов с методами искусственного интеллекта, машинного обучения и квантовыми вычислениями. Это позволяет значительно увеличить вычислительную скорость, адаптивность и надежность навигационных систем в долгосрочных космических миссиях, обеспечивая стабильное управление и корректировку курсов.

Какие основные вызовы стоят перед применением генетических алгоритмов в реальных межзвёздных миссиях?

Ключевые вызовы связаны с ограниченными вычислительными ресурсами на борту космических аппаратов, необходимостью высокой автономности систем при длительных полётах, а также с необходимостью точного моделирования внешних факторов, таких как гравитационное влияние и космическая пыль. Эти факторы требуют разработки более эффективных и адаптивных версий алгоритмов.

Как развитие генетических алгоритмов может повлиять на будущее межзвёздных путешествий?

Дальнейшее совершенствование генетических алгоритмов способно значительно снизить затраты на навигацию, увеличить точность курса и время автономной работы космических аппаратов. Это откроет новые возможности для проведения долгосрочных межзвёздных миссий, исследования новых звёздных систем и расширения границ человечества в космосе.

Похожие записи